Piece it together intenisty bug
Piece it Together isn't granting extra turns when cast from the graveyard with the proper intensity to do so. It also doesn't function when copied at the proper intensity level.
Dreadhorde Arcanist
Snapcaster Mage
Sea gate storm caller
None of the listed work.
When exiled with Bloodthirsty Adversary, it doesn't retain intensity, but I'm unsure if that is within the bounds of the rules.

I can confirm that it also doesn't work with "Founding the Third Path" exiling it from graveyard and letting you cast a copy. Why wouldn't the copy keep the same intensity as the card it was copied from?
